Excel VBA makro - kas ir VBA makro programmā Excel?

VBA makro izmanto Visual Basic lietojumprogrammu programmā Excel, lai izveidotu pielāgotas lietotāju ģenerētas funkcijas un paātrinātu manuālos uzdevumus, izveidojot automatizētus procesus. Turklāt VBA var izmantot, lai piekļūtu Windows lietojumprogrammu saskarnei (API). Viens no tā galvenajiem izmantošanas veidiem ir mainīt un pielāgot lietotāja saskarni, izveidojot personalizētas rīkjoslas, izvēlnes, dialoglodziņus un veidlapas.

Lai uzzinātu vairāk, tūlīt sāciet Finance Excel VBA kursu!

VBA makro kurss

Kā izveidot VBA makro

Atsevišķā rakstā Finance apspriež, kas ir VBA Excel. VBA VBA nozīmē Visual Basic for Applications. Excel VBA ir Microsoft programmēšanas valoda programmai Excel un visām pārējām Microsoft Office programmām, piemēram, Word un PowerPoint. Office suite programmām ir kopīga programmēšanas valoda. un kā piekļūt VBA redaktoram. Kopumā, nospiežot Alt + F11 programmā Excel, tiek atvērts VBA logs un lietotājs var sākt kodēt makro.

Lai sāktu kodēšanu, lietotājam būs jāizveido moduļa fails. Moduļu failos ir makro grupa. Lai izveidotu jaunu moduli, nospiediet Insert> Module. Pēc izvēles lietotājs var nosaukt šo moduli, izmantojot rekvizītu logu redaktora apakšējā kreisajā stūrī. Vienkārši ievadiet jaunu moduļa nosaukumu un nospiediet enter.

Kā nosaukt Excel VBA makro

Lai sāktu, makro ir jāpiešķir unikāls nosaukums. Šis nosaukums nevar atbilst citiem makro, un tas parasti nevar atbilst citu Excel īpašību, funkciju un rīku nosaukumam. Makro nosaukums ir tas, ko lietotājs izmantos, lai izsauktu makro darbībā.

Lai definētu makro nosaukumu, lietotājam jāievada apakšnosaukums () un redaktora kodēšanas logā jānospiež “Enter”. Nospiežot taustiņu Enter, logs automātiski tiks aizpildīts ar vispārējo Excel makro formātu. Piemēram, lai nosauktu makro “Finance Macro”, lietotājam jāievada “Sub cfiMacro ()” un jānospiež enter. VBA redaktors dažas rindas zem “Sub” automātiski pievienos rindu “End Sub”.

VBA makro apakšprocedūra

Piezīme: Visu makro, funkciju vai mainīgo VBA vārdu rakstīšanas vispārīgais princips ir izmantot mazos burtus, ja ir tikai viens vārds, un katra jauna vārda sākumā izmantot lielos burtus. VBA nosaukumos parasti nevar būt atstarpes. Tā kā Finanses makro ir divi vārdi, tas jāraksta kā cfiMacro. Tomēr šīs ir tikai labākās prakses vadlīnijas, un tās nav obligāti jāievēro.

Apakšvārds VBA

Rindiņa Sub Name () norāda redaktoram makro koda sākumu. End Sub apzīmē beigas. Ja lietotājs to vēlas, viņš vai viņa varētu izveidot otru jaunu makro, sākot jaunu apakšnosaukuma () rindu zem pirmās beigu apakšdaļas. Izmēģiniet to, un jums vajadzētu pamanīt, ka Excel automātiski izveidos līniju starp diviem dažādiem makro.

VBA makro apakšnosaukums

Šī ir Excel makro pamatstruktūra. Nākamais solis, pirms pāriet uz faktisko procesa kodēšanu, ir definēt mainīgos, kurus lietotājs izmantos kodā. Iespējams, jūs interesēs mūsu pilnvērtīgais Excel VBA makro kurss. Noklikšķiniet šeit, lai sāktu kursu tūlīt!

Papildu resursi

Paldies, ka izlasījāt finanšu ievada rokasgrāmatu VBA makro programmā Excel. Lai turpinātu mācīties un virzīt savu karjeru, pārbaudiet šos papildu finanšu resursus:

  • Excel saīsnes (PC un Mac) Excel saīsnes PC Mac Excel saīsnes - vissvarīgāko un izplatītāko MS Excel saīsņu saraksts PC un Mac lietotājiem, finansēm, grāmatvedības profesijām. Īsinājumtaustiņi paātrina modelēšanas prasmes un ietaupa laiku. Uzziniet rediģēšanu, formatēšanu, navigāciju, lenti, īpašo ielīmēšanu, datu apstrādi, formulu un šūnu rediģēšanu un citus saīsnes
  • Advanced Excel formulas Advanced Excel formulām jāzina Šīs modernās Excel formulas ir ļoti svarīgas, lai tās zinātu, un jūsu finanšu analīzes prasmes pārcels uz nākamo līmeni. Advanced Excel funkcijas, kas jums jāzina. Uzziniet 10 labākās Excel formulas, kuras regulāri lieto visi pasaules klases finanšu analītiķi. Šīs prasmes uzlabos jūsu darbu izklājlapās jebkurā karjerā
  • Excel funkciju saraksts Funkciju saraksts ar finanšu analītiķiem vissvarīgākajām Excel funkcijām. Šī apkrāptu lapa aptver 100 funkcijas, kuras ir ļoti svarīgi zināt kā Excel analītiķi
  • Bezmaksas Excel kurss

Jaunākās publikācijas

$config[zx-auto] not found$config[zx-overlay] not found